Overview of International Schools in Montenegro
Montenegro, a picturesque Balkan country with its Adriatic coastline and mountainous landscapes, is not only a tourist destination but also a place where expatriates choose to settle, attracted by its beauty, lifestyle, and growing economic opportunities. With an increasing expat community, the demand for international education has surged, leading to the establishment of several reputable international schools. These institutions cater to diverse nationalities, providing curricula from the American, British, and IB (International Baccalaureate) systems, among others, thus making Montenegro an excellent place for expat families considering educational options for their children.
Criteria for Selecting the Best International Schools
When evaluating the best international schools in Montenegro, several criteria should be considered to ensure the optimal educational environment for students:
Accreditation: This ensures that the school meets certain standards of quality and is recognized internationally. Accreditation bodies such as the Council of International Schools (CIS) and New England Association of Schools and Colleges (NEASC) are significant indicators of quality.
Curriculum: Whether it’s American, British, or International Baccalaureate (IB), the curriculum offered is a crucial factor depending on the educational goals for the child.
Facilities: Modern, well-equipped facilities that support academic and extracurricular activities contribute significantly to a child’s education.
Faculty Qualifications: Experienced and qualified teachers who can deliver the curriculum effectively and support the holistic development of students.
Language Support: Especially important for students who are non-native English speakers, language support can help them integrate better and excel academically.
Extracurricular Activities: These are important for the all-round development of a child, offering chances for students to explore interests beyond academics.
Feedback from Parents and Students: Insights from the school community can provide real-life testimonials to the school’s environment and education quality.
Top International Schools in Montenegro
Montenegro boasts several top-tier international schools that are recognized for their quality education and excellent facilities. Here are some of the most notable ones:
Knightsbridge Schools International Montenegro
Located in the beautiful Bay of Kotor, Knightsbridge Schools International (KSI) Montenegro is part of the renowned KSI global network. The school offers the International Baccalaureate (IB) curriculum for children from pre-kindergarten through to the diploma programme (ages 3-18). With a waterfront campus that boasts state-of-the-art facilities, KSI Montenegro focuses on developing inquiring, knowledgeable, and caring young people.
Accreditations: International Baccalaureate Organization (IBO), Council of International Schools (CIS).
Facilities: Swimming pool, science labs, art studios, a theatre, and sports fields.
Language Support: Offers support in English, with additional languages taught including French and Spanish.
QSI International School of Montenegro
QSI International School of Montenegro, part of the Quality Schools International (QSI) network, is located in the capital city, Podgorica. The school serves students from 3 years old to secondary school level, offering an American-based curriculum with Advanced Placement (AP) courses at the secondary level. QSI maintains a non-selective student admissions policy, focusing on success for all students in the classroom.
Accreditations: Middle States Association of Colleges and Schools (MSA).
Facilities: Libraries, computer labs, science labs, and sports facilities.
Language Support: Intensive English classes are available.
International School of Montenegro (ISM)
The International School of Montenegro (ISM) in Tivat offers a British-based curriculum and caters to students from early years to secondary education. The school is known for its rigorous academic standards and a strong focus on the holistic development of students.
Accreditations: Cambridge International School, Council of British International Schools (COBIS).
Facilities: Modern classrooms, a library, sports courts, and an ICT suite.
Language Support: English as an Additional Language (EAL) program is available.
Choosing the Right School
Choosing the right international school in Montenegro involves careful consideration of what each school offers in terms of curriculum, facilities, faculty, extracurricular activities, and overall environment. Parents should visit schools, meet with teachers and administrators, and consider their children’s educational needs and aspirations. It is also beneficial to connect with other parents and students to gain insights into their experiences with the school.
